職責描述:
1、負責業務系統的架構設計、重構、優化,以及業務系統間的接口設計;
2、對業務系統存在的問題梳理,并提供解決方案,負責核心架構部分代碼的編寫、指導;
3、對負責業務系統的工作進度和質量最終負責;
4、保證負責業務系統高可用、高性能和可擴展性;
5、參與公司重大項目架構設計評審工作,并給出建設性意見;
6、指導下級工程師工作并對其工作結果負責。
任職要求:
1、本科及以上學歷,計算機、數學、自動化等工科類專業;
2、5年及以上工作經驗,互聯網、金融、銀行等行業背景優先;
3、計算機技能要求:
(1)了解Web及前端技術開發經驗 HTML5,CSS,JS,至少掌握一種前端框架;
(2)熟練使用Java語言進行編程,熟悉WebLogic、Tomcat、Redis配置和部署;
(3)熟悉開源架構,如SpringMVC、SpringBoot、Mybatis等,熟練使用Maven、Git、Jenkins、Jira等;
(4)熟悉Oracle或MySQL,熟練掌握SQL語句及如何優化,了解存儲過程的開發;
(5)研究過HTTP協議、ELK、緩存、JVM調優、序列化、NIO等;
(6)熟悉高性能、高并發系統設計方案并有豐富實踐經驗,如分布式緩存、RPC框架、消息隊列等。
4、其他:
(1)擁有信貸業務系統開發經驗者優先;
(2) 擁有賬務、支付系統開發經驗者優先;
(3)有APP后臺服務、移動網關開發經驗者優先;
(4)擁有互聯網產品開發經驗者優先。